Bias-compensated least-squares method is a consistent estimation method for parameters of pulse transfer functions in the presence of input and output noise. The method is based on compensation of asymptotic bias on the least-squares estimates by making use of noise variances estimates. In this paper, a new type of noise variances estimation method is proposed to overcome drawbacks of previously proposed methods. The main feature of the proposed method is to introduce a generalized least-squares type estimator in order to estimate noise variances. Results of computer simulations are presented to verify the performance of the method.
